The Role
We’re seeking a strategic and pragmatic senior leader who can balance big-picture thinking with practical delivery. As a Senior Operations Manager, you will have full accountability for the planning, development, investment, operation and maintenance of all aspects of our work across this critical geography.
As Senior Operations Manager for Merseyside, you’ll hold single-point accountability for delivering our business plan outcomes in the region-from driving operation excellence and regulatory compliance to ensuring the long-term sustainability of our infrastructure. You’ll be responsible for the delivery of £50 million annual operating budget and play a crucial role in making strategic decisions that have real impact on our customers, communities and the environment.
This role requires confident and people-first leadership. You’ll bring together cross functional teams, build lasting partnerships and create a culture of performance and inclusion all while ensuring day-to-day operations run to the highest standards.
Key Accountabilities
* Lead and inspire the area business team, developing a high-performing, inclusive culture that reflects our values and enhances United Utilities reputation.
* Translate the corporate strategy into a clear county-level business plan and budget, including active sponsorship of major business change projects.
* Lead all aspects of asset planning, operational delivery and maintenance across Merseyside to optimise cost, quality and risk.
* Sponsor key capital interventions and drive improvement in asset performance and value to customers.
* Contribute to regulatory submissions, including price review.
* Build and manage strong operational relationships with internal teams and external suppliers, ensuring timely responses to events and incidents.
* Champion health, safety and wellbeing in the Home Safe and well programme.
* Establish and maintain a strong governance framework covering operational risk, security compliance contingency and business continuity.
Skills & Experience
* Educated to degree level or equivalent ideally supported by a relevant professional qualification or post-graduate accreditation.
* Extensive experience in leading and managing an operational business function, with a demonstrable track record of strategic planning, budgetary control, resource management, and overall business performance management.
* A proven track record in planning and managing the investment and operational needs of a complex, technically driven asset base, with a focus on delivering improvements in customer service, quality, efficiency and cost effectiveness.
* Significant leadership and people management capability with a proven ability to translate corporate strategy into departmental business plans and budgets, drive performance, and build high-performing, inclusive teams.
* Strong delivery experience with the ability to execute complex plans and drive continuous improvement across diverse operations.
* Strong commercial acumen ideally gained through managing large-scale contracts or working in partnership with third-party suppliers.
* Resilience and the ability to perform under pressure maintaining focus, clarity and judgement while handling the demands of a significant operational leadership role.
